The Route Begins to Gel

Southern California Regional Caravan Captain, Hib Halverson, tells the SoCalCar eNews that a 5-day schedule now has the inside track, though the final decision as to the route still hasn't been made. "I had meetings with both Bob Kroener of the Arizona/New Mexico Caravan and "Tuna" Dobbins of the North Texas/Oklahoma Caravan," Halverson said. "Unfortunately, Capt. Kroener's group is not going join the SoCalCar, the NTX/OK and Arkansas Caravans on the trip to Bowling Green. The AZ/NM group will use some of the same route as the SoCalCar but will arrive in Bowling Green sometime Thursday morning rather than Wednesday night."

Capt. Halverson went on to say that there are road tour events along with Bowling Green Assembly Plant tours available all day on Thursday as part of the NCM's 15th Anniversary weekend. As one of the main reasons people go on the National Corvette Caravan is that it ends in Bowling Green where they can get a tour of the Corvette Plant. "Plant tours on the weekends of big NCM events," Halverson said, "fill-up quick-real quick. In fact, on the '03 we had people who couldn't get on Plant tours because they waited too late to sign-up. The SoCalCar needs to get to B.G. on Wednesday to leave all day Thursday available to our Caravanners who want to go on the many road tours the NCM organizes or go through Bowling Green Assembly and the SoCalCar Organizing Team is going to make sure that happens."

"In my meeting with Tuna Dobbins, Captain of the TX/OK Caravan," Halverson continued, "I believe the route he and Capt, Jan Marshall of the Arkansas Caravan may take through eastern Oklahoma and Arkansas will be different than the route taken in '03 with the Caravan exploring parts of old US66 in OK."

In talking with sources on the SoCalCar O.T. the eNews feels that right now, the tentative schedule and route for the SoCalCar could be:

Fri. 8/28/09: Feeder Caravans from San Diego and Santa Barbara > Fontana CA
Sat. 8/29/09: Fontana CA > Flagstaff AZ and will include Historic 66 from Kingman to Flagstaff AZ but not H66 in eastern CA
Sun. 8/30/09: Flagstaff > Tucumcari NM and may include parts of old US66 east of Albuquerque
Mon. 8/31/09: Tucumcari > Oklahoma City OK
Tue. 9/1/09: Oklahoma City > tba and may include parts of old US 66
Wed. 9/2/09: tba > Bowling Green KY

The Quest for Sponsors

To put on an five-day event for 500 people costs quite a bit of money. The Regional Caravans all raise money. Some raise a little. Others raise a lot. Some Regional Caravans sell merchandise to raise money, others choose to acquire sponsors who donate the money. All Regional Caravans donate any money left over after the event to the National Corvette Museum.

The Southern California Caravan Organizing Team's "Sponsorship Committee" of Brent Hicks and Hib Halverson, are starting to line-up corporate sponsors for the '09 event. "Obviously, we are first going to call-on the major sponsors of the '03 SoCalCar," Halverson said. "In fact, I'm flying to Florida next week to meet with executives of a major Corvette-related company which was a key sponsor in '03. No, I can't tell what company it is right now, but if you have the '03 route book, you can look though it and see that there were a handful of major sponsors and it one of those companies. Hopefully, I'll have more to tell you, soon."
